State, Regional & Local Taxes

🇸🇦 Saudi ArabiaZakat, Salam & Municipality Fees

Saudi Arabia has no local or regional income taxes on individuals — the Kingdom operates as a unitary state for tax purposes. Municipalities (amanaat) collect fees for commercial licences, land use, and services. Zakat (Islamic wealth levy at 2.5% of Zakat base) applies to Saudi nationals and GCC citizens with business income, instead of income tax. Foreign companies pay CIT at 20%. The government levies municipality fees of 2.5% on commercial and residential rents. Vision 2030 is transforming the fiscal landscape.

🇦🇿 AzerbaijanMunicipal & Local Taxes

Azerbaijan's 67 districts and Baku have limited independent tax powers. The Ministry of Taxes administers all national taxes centrally. Municipalities collect land and property taxes within national frameworks. Oil and gas companies operate under Production Sharing Agreements (PSAs) with the state oil company SOCAR, which have special tax provisions. ASAN (service centres) have modernized tax filing considerably. The Strategic Road Map (2016) targets economic diversification away from oil revenue dependency.
